Escaped Alone is a collaborative performer project connected to the celebrated play by Caryl Churchill. The piece, originally premiered at the Royal Court Theatre in London in January 2016 under the direction of James MacDonald, features four women in their 70s sharing tea and gossip in a garden, weaving in surreal apocalyptic monologues. Typical runtimes range from 50–60 minutes, with extended configurations totaling around 1 hour 40 minutes when paired as a double bill in certain productions (notably Manchester 2025).
